GameSpy: Pure Preview

GameSpy writes: "Last week, we got a chance to mix it up multiplayer-style on the mud-encrusted tracks of Disney's Pure. Even in the early edition that we played, Pure already seems to be shaping up into an intuitive skid fest with simple controls that leave you free to focus on tricking your way to first place. The physics capture the squirrelly nature of ATV racing while the trick system encourages you to push these unstable and horrifically dangerous vehicles past the bounds of sanity. It's a lot like the old SSX series, but with ATVs instead of snowboards and goofy character avatars. The tracks also seem to offer a plethora of hidden shortcuts and branching paths and deliver a good amount of variety in any given race. During multiplayer, the numerous shortcuts mean that veterans ride with a substantial advantage, adding a bit of extra depth that is surprising in such a simple racer."
